A 500 ml 5-neck round-bottom flask, rendered inert with nitrogen and equipped with paddle stirrer, dropping funnel, thermometer, and water separator with reflux condenser, is charged with 70 g (0.5 mol) of methyl-trimethoxysilane (available commercially from Wacker Chemie AG), 6 g (0.05 mol) of trimethylmethoxysilane (prepared in the laboratory by reacting trimethyl-chlorosilane with methanol), and 98.6 g of Isopar E (isoparaffinic hydrocarbon mixture having a boiling range of 113-143° C., available commercially from ExxonMobil). The water separator is filled to the brim with Isopar E. Accompanied by stirring at 300 rpm, a solution of 40.5 g of 50% strength aqueous potassium hydroxide solution (0.36 mol of potassium hydroxide) and 3.2 g of demineralized water is metered in over 6 minutes. During this metered addition, the mixture heats up to 63° C. The mixture is heated to boiling temperature (70° C.). The distillate separates out as the bottom phase in the water separator. Up to a boiling temperature of 118° C., 60.3 g of colorless, slightly turbid distillate are accumulated, and—according to analysis by gas chromatography—contains 84 area % of methanol, 10.8 area % of water, 3.3 area % of Isopar E, and 0.8 area % of trimethylmethoxysilane. The suspension which remains is subsequently evaporated to dryness with stirring under a full oil-pump vacuum (5 hPa) to 70° C. This gives 55.9 g of fine, white, free-flowable powder with a solids content of 99.9% (determined using the HR73 halogen moisture analyzer from Mettler Toledo at 160° C.). A 50% strength aqueous solution prepared with this powder exhibits no precipitation even after being stored at room temperature for two weeks in the absence of air.
